Invoking inner class constructor from method of second inner class #7

Invoking inner class constructor from method belonging to second inner class does not convert correctly to C#.

Java:


public class A
{
    public class B
    {
    }

    public class C
    {
    	B b;

    	C()
    	{
            b = new B();
    	}
    }
}

C# conversion of class C:


    public class A_0024C: object
    {
        public A _o;
        public A_0024B b_f;

        public A_0024C(A _o):base()
        {
            this._o = _o;
            this.b_f = new A_0024B(this);
        }
    }

That is, C invokes constructor of B replacing A with itself.
